    Will Golovkin delay VADA testing until less than a month out for the 3rd time?

    He didn't start VADA testing for Lemieux and Wade until the month of the fight.

    Lemieux
    According to RDS, middleweight champion David Lemieux and Gennady Golovkin have reached an agreement on the terms of their drug testing protocol for their unification bout on October 17th at Madison Square Garden in New York. The information was announced by Lemieux's handlers, Eye of The Tiger Management.


    26 September - Fight 17 October



    Wade


    March 25 - Fight 23 April



    Is he going to do it again for the Brook fight?

    If he does then questions should start being asked.
